    Spin Motion in Electron Transmission through Ultrathin Ferromagnetic Films Accessed by Photoelectron Spectroscopy

    Full text link
    Ab initio and model calculations demonstrate that the spin motion of electrons transmitted through ferromagnetic films can be analyzed in detail by means of angle- and spin-resolved core-level photoelectron spectroscopy. The spin motion appears as precession of the photoelectron spin polarization around and as relaxation towards the magnetization direction. In a systematic study for ultrathin Fe films on Pd(001) we elucidate its dependence on the Fe film thickness and on the Fe electronic structure.     Dynamical electron transport through a nanoelectromechanical wire in a magnetic field

    Full text link
    We investigate dynamical transport properties of interacting electrons moving in a vibrating nanoelectromechanical wire in a magnetic field. We have built an exactly solvable model in which electric current and mechanical oscillation are treated fully quantum mechanically on an equal footing. Quantum mechanically fluctuating Aharonov-Bohm phases obtained by the electrons cause nontrivial contribution to mechanical vibration and electrical conduction of the wire. We demonstrate our theory by calculating the admittance of the wire which are influenced by the multiple interplay between the mechanical and the electrical energy scales, magnetic field strength, and the electron-electron interaction

    Preventive home care of frail older people: a review of recent case management studies.

    Preventive actions targeting community-dwelling frail older people will be increasingly important with the growing number of very old and thereby also frail older people. This study aimed to explore and summarize the empirical literature on recent studies of case/care management interventions for community-dwelling frail older people and especially with regard to the content of the interventions and the nurse's role and outcome of it. Very few of the interventions took either a preventive or a rehabilitative approach using psycho-educative interventions focusing, for instance, on self-care activities, risk prevention, health complaints management or how to preserve or strengthen social activities, community involvement and functional ability. Moreover, it was striking that very few included a family-oriented approach also including support and education for informal caregivers. Thus it seems that the content of case/care management needs to be expanded and more influenced by a salutogenic health care perspective. Targeting frail older people seemed to benefit from a standardized two-stage strategy for inclusion and for planning the interventions. A comprehensive geriatric assessment seemed useful as a base. Nurses, preferably trained in gerontological practice, have a key role in case/care management for frail older people. This approach calls for developing the content of case/care management so that it involves a more salutogenic, rehabilitative and family-oriented approach. To this end it may be useful for nurses to strengthen their psychosocial skills or develop close collaboration with social workers. The outcome measures examined in this study represented one of three perspectives: the consumer's perspective, the perspective of health care consumption or the recipient's health and functional ability.
